Anyway, quick overview of new servers:
- mayor -- single P3 866 Mhz, 256 MB RAM. Purpose: bitch box. "staging server". SSH in here, run netsaint and other monitoring tools, edit files, update from cvs, push to other web slaves (well, broadcast to them that they should rsync from the bitch box ... "masterweb" CNAME internally, actually). right now kyle (a webslave) is our staging machine but it sucks when we hammer it temporarily.
- timmy, gobbles -- dual something, 2 GB RAM. Purpose: slave database servers.
And stuff that's been ordered but not yet here:
- jimbo, ned -- dual
P4P3 1.24 Ghz, 512 MB RAM. Purpose: more web slaves. Since these are the first 1.24 Ghz machines we'll have (the rest are 1.0 Ghz or 866 Mhz) we'll probably make these the paid user one(s). - jesus -- dual (quad-capable) 2MB cache Xeon 700 Mhz, 12 GB RAM, IBM enclosure/ServRAID/drives ... 288 GB SCSI RAID array (hardly full at all ... can add tons of drives later). Purpose: new database server and NFS server for image gallery photos and file attachments to posts.
